Short answer: Yes, the punishment is fair since you decided to fight fire with fire instead of just muting, reporting and moving on.

Long answer: The reason you got permabanned is because you already received a 14-day ban and/or at least 35-games worth of chat restrictions, but instead of shaping up you continued with the same kind of behavior that got you punished in the first place. Not only that but because you received a 14-day ban already the IFS assigned the next available punishment-a permaban in this case. Regardless of how other people act retaliation (aka the "they started it" excuse) is not accepted here. Next time just mute, report and move on rather than engaging in a flame war.

P.S. If that other person truly was behaving poorly then you should have reported him. By not reporting him you're telling the IFS that you saw nothing wrong with his behavior, and before you say that reporting doesn't work it does. After all, you got permabanned because of reports from others who didn't appreciate your poor behavior.

Riot wants you to take a screenshot and mute any offenders, then report them after game. Responding to them in chat places your account in jeopardy.

I've come across many a troll attempting to bait me into saying something they can report me over. I just mute, screenshot the chat and report/ make a ticket and on to the next game.

There's no point in actually engaging with the randoms and their tilt/ stress issues. You'll only ever see them for that one game, then for all intents and purposes they cease to exist, melding back into the million player pool that is the league of legends base.

Don't try to rationalize with people either. This is a stressful game and you don't know the emotional state others are in. Don't assume they are able or willing to listen to reason.

Lastly the game is very fast paced. Nobody has time to hold debates. Mute whomever you need to and focus on the game/ mini map/ what you can do to help the team win.
